The HABA website is very well organized and easy to navigate.  After clicking on the Products link, I noticed the various categories were listed on the left side of the page.  There, toys are classified by category (baby, toddler, preschooler, etc.), price, age group, manufacturer and awards.  Several of HABA’s products have the distinction of receiving The National Parent Seal of Approval, Parent’s Choice awards and so many more awards.  As a parent, it does matter to me how toys are viewed in the industry and if I see that a toy has won several awards, I definitely check it out.

The toys also meet my daughter’s approval.  She loves the Building Blocks Domino because of the fun colors and the ability to “knock it down.”  One of her favorite things to do is sort them by color.  Playing with the blocks can be as simple or as complex as you want them to be.  With 61 domino blocks, 8 pieces of untreated wood, 6 building block clamps, 2 wheel clamps, 2 conveyor wheels, 2 metal rods with eyelet and 6 marbles, the possibilities are endless.  There are enough pieces that that at least two kids can play with the blocks and have ample pieces.
